The Horrible History of the World presents the
foul but fascinating story of humans from brain-nibbling Neanderthals
to terrified teenage soldiers in the twentieth century.
You can discover:

Why Alexander the Great banned beards
What smelly sport was played by samurai warriors
And who tried to bump off her enemies with a cake made with poisoned
bath-water.
 
It's all you ever need to know about the
wicked world - all the gore and more!

About Terry Deary

Terry Deary is the author of over 300 fiction and non-fiction books, which have been published in 32 languages. His historical  fiction  for older children Tudor Terror has been praised as 'a marvellous blend of fact and fiction' (School Librarian).
